#ff1dea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ff1dea is composed of 100% red, 11.4%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.6% magenta, 8.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 305.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 55.7%. #ff1dea color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3aff with #ff00d5.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

#ff1dea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ff1dea has RGB values of R:255, G:29,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.08, K:0. Its decimal value is 16719338.

Hex triplet ff1dea #ff1dea
RGB Decimal 255, 29, 234 rgb(255,29,234)
RGB Percent 100, 11.4, 91.8 rgb(100%,11.4%,91.8%)
CMYK 0, 89, 8, 0
HSL 305.6°, 100, 55.7 hsl(305.6,100%,55.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 305.6°, 88.6, 100
Web Safe ff33ff #ff33ff
CIE-LAB 59.964, 93.053, -49.709
XYZ 56.53, 28.084, 80.281
xyY 0.343, 0.17, 28.084
CIE-LCH 59.964, 105.498, 331.889
CIE-LUV 59.964, 91.062, -90.91
Hunter-Lab 52.994, 97.671, -52.723
Binary 11111111, 00011101, 11101010

Shades and Tints of #ff1dea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090009 is the darkest color, while #fff5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ff1dea

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#978595 is the less saturated color, while #ff1dea is the most saturated one.
